Specifies the gain expected from the DUT after applying DPD on the input waveform.

AverageGain0

The DPD polynomial or lookup table is computed by assuming that the linearized gain expected from the DUT after applying DPD on the input waveform is equal to the average power gain provided by the DUT without DPD.

LinearRegionGain1

The DPD polynomial or lookup table is computed by assuming that the linearized gain expected from the DUT after applying DPD on the input waveform is equal to the gain provided by the DUT, without DPD, to the parts of the reference waveform that do not drive the DUT into non-linear gain-expansion or compression regions of its input-output characteristics. The measurement computes the linear region gain as the average gain experienced by the parts of the reference waveform that are below a threshold which is computed as shown in the following equation: Linear region threshold (dBm) = Max {-25, Min {reference waveform power} + 6, DUT Average Input Power -15}.

PeakInputPowerGain2

The DPD polynomial or lookup table is computed by assuming that the linearized gain expected from the DUT after applying DPD on the input waveform is equal to the average power gain provided by the DUT, without DPD, to all the samples of the reference waveform for which the magnitude is greater than the peak power in the <format tpye="italics">reference waveform (dBm)</format> - 0.5 dB.
